Dizzee Rascal - Politics

Politics

Around 2004, English newspapers were quoting one particular lyric by Dizzee Rascal – "I'm a problem for Anthony Blair".

During the 2008 US presidential elections, Dizzee gave a live interview to Newsnight presenter Jeremy Paxman, in which he described Barack Obama as "an immediate symbol of unity". Addressed by Paxman as "Mr Rascal" at one point, he suggested that hip-hop played an important part in encouraging young voters and humorously opined that he could well one day become Prime Minister. In the same interview Rascal stated that, "If you believe you can achieve, innit," thus showing his agreement with Paxman's humorous remark.
